The main objective of the course is to give the student the appropriate and necessary information about the new medium in the fashion world.Learn and analyze the history of fashion in film.Criticize and discuss existing fashion films and productions related to fashion film that have been influential in the fashion world(music videos, TV series, shorts, etc.)Recognize the different genres within fashion film.Understand how to use a fashion film according to specific necessities.Become familiarized with the key ingredients that are crucial to creating an impactful and visually pleasing film.Know the vital steps necessary to take before getting to work and how to budget a film.Be able to create an appealing fashion film for a fashion brand.The know-how of what to do after creating a fashion film (post-production, communication, distribution, etc.).

Course aim
With the emergence of the evolving genre of Fashion Films IED Madrid offers a course that divulges into the history of the genre, the diversity of what is available in fashion film and how to use this newest medium for fashion, the new catwalk.A course based on theory and history with hands on experience in critiquing existing fashion films and learning from experts in the growing field, using the technical tools and nurturing an individual sensibility.Along with a theoretical introduction to the newest genre, students will learn from the some of the best in the fashion film world about how to create a fashion film to express a brands values, as an artistic form of expression and/or as a marketing tool.
